# Kids Empire Chicago Kedzie

> Indoor playground features dragon and castle theme with two big slides and a dedicated toddler section. Atmosphere is low key and quiet, with occasional music and lighting changes for parties. Space feels spacious yet sometimes crowded due to seating arrangement.

## Good to know

- The facility charges $20 per child for unlimited access.
- The ball pit is often closed for cleaning, so check availability.
- Expect limited food options; only snacks are available on-site.
- The facility closes early at 8:00 or 8:30 PM, so plan accordingly.
- There are two slide carts, which may lead to wait times for kids.
